Block
#13,339,026
8w
11 txs249,840 confs
Transactions
11
Total Output
₳6,517,168.15
$984.8K
Fees
₳4.16
Size
15.19 KB
15,559 bytes
Details
Hash
083dfa80604dcf0ba7a8aec8e0c5a614c065a2a7da545dffa1b4767bbe570316
Epoch / Slot
Epoch 627 · slot 185,602,931 · epoch-slot 102,131
Timestamp
8w · Sun, 26 Apr 2026 02:07:02 GMT
Block producer
VRF key
vrf_vk1u…ys76vdcq
Op cert
e5a2127c…f1487e55
Op cert counter
20